The MSI Immerse GH50 Wireless headset stands out for its careful design, offering increased comfort for prolonged use. The MSI brand is recognized for its innovation and quality, thus ensuring reliable performance tailored to users' needs. The user experience is optimized thanks to well-thought-out features, and a user manual is included to facilitate product handling. However, this model has some notable drawbacks. The battery life is limited, which can be inconvenient for heavy users, requiring frequent recharges. Additionally, the weight of the headset can become uncomfortable during extended use. Although the sound quality is decent, it may not satisfy audiophiles seeking a high-end audio experience. Furthermore, the companion software might lack some advanced features and could be somewhat unintuitive for certain users. Finally, the price of the headset could be considered high compared to other wireless models offering similar features. In summary, the MSI Immerse GH50 Wireless is a solid choice for those looking for a comfortable and reliable wireless headset, but it is important to keep in mind its limitations in terms of battery life and weight.Score details
